Eddie78 (1316) ticked Cascade from Gloucester Brewery 4 years ago
Can online from The Natural Grocery Store. Pours a hazy amber red colour with a huge foamy off-white head. Aromas of caramel, fruit cake and berries. Taste has more notes of caramel, fruit cake and berries with an added hint of nuts, citrusy orange and peppery spice. Very mild hop on the sweetish finish. Medium to full body, low carbonation and smooth slightly sticky mouthfeel. Very good tasty beer especially for the low abv.

Theydon_Bois (46224) reviewed Cascade from Gloucester Brewery 4 years ago
Appearance - 8 | Aroma - 6 | Flavor - 6 | Texture - 8 | Overall - 7
Cask at the Sandford Park alehouse Cheltenham, 16/07/21. Reddish amber with a decent light beige cap. Nose is dusty fruits, caramel, dried red berry fruits. Taste comprises fruit slice, brown breads, dusty hops, red berry tingle, brown bread. Medium bodied, soft carbonation. Semi drying close with balanced hop bitterness. Decent cask ale.

simontomlinson (7969) reviewed Cascade from Gloucester Brewery 6 years ago
Appearance - 6 | Aroma - 7 | Flavor - 6 | Texture - 6 | Overall - 6.5
Thin rocky off white head left a spotty cover on a mahogany coloured still body. Malt, demerara, red berries & spices aroma. Medium bodied soft over the tongue with a light clean back. Sweet berries, sweet citrus, spices & dark sugar to the fore with tangy, bitter citrus finish.
